Regularly Requested Questions
This part addresses frequent queries and uncertainties relating to the visible representations utilized throughout the WeatherBug utility on the Android working system.
Query 1: What’s the significance of the lightning bolt image throughout the WeatherBug utility?
The lightning bolt image denotes the presence of lightning exercise within the speedy neighborhood. Proximity and frequency of lightning strikes could also be indicated by variations in image depth or extra graphical components.
Query 2: How does the appliance differentiate between varied types of precipitation utilizing symbols?
Rain is often represented by raindrop icons, snow by snowflake icons, sleet by a mix of raindrops and snowflakes, and hail by small ice pellet icons. Particular image designs might range barely primarily based on app model and settings.
Query 3: What does a coloured temperature icon signify?
Temperature icons typically make the most of a colour gradient to visually characterize temperature ranges. Blue sometimes signifies cooler temperatures, whereas crimson signifies hotter temperatures. The particular temperature vary related to every colour could also be detailed within the app’s settings or assist documentation.
Query 4: How are wind course and velocity indicated throughout the WeatherBug utility?
Wind course is usually indicated by an arrow pointing within the course from which the wind is blowing. Wind velocity could also be represented by the size or thickness of the arrow, or by numerical values displayed alongside the arrow.
Query 5: What does the “UV Index” image characterize and why is it essential?
The UV Index image represents the extent of ultraviolet radiation from the solar at a given time. A better UV Index signifies a larger threat of sunburn and potential pores and skin injury, necessitating acceptable solar safety measures.
Query 6: How are extreme climate alerts conveyed by the app’s symbols?
Extreme climate alerts, similar to twister warnings or flash flood warnings, are sometimes conveyed by outstanding symbols, similar to stylized depictions of tornadoes or flooding, typically accompanied by alert-specific colour coding (e.g., crimson for warnings, orange for watches).
